Abstract

Drone and GPS technologies are advancing productive, efficient, and sustainable agricultural systems through data driven methods, and transforming crop agricultural recording of real-time data for soil analysis, pest control, logistics use, and specific tasks to monitor crop health. Providing drones with precisely localized terrain, enables automated mechanical guidance for precise use for operations, and mapping of fields helps provide more accurate farming strategies This accuracy helps in decision making and operational efficiency and reduces waste and environmental impact. This chapter describes how the integration of drone and GPS technologies in agriculture demonstrates advantages in infrastructure management, crop management, and yield improvement, as well as the potential to enhance practices a sustainable development and preservation of the environment.
